discussed the excitement that came with joining the franchise and getting the chance to contribute to its success, explaining,"I met with the creator of Mario,. And we talked through the process of what I was thinking should be the idea behind it. Since this movie is so cinematic and so big, going into that world of film, it needed to have its own new themes. You know, from Princess Peach to Bowser to the main Mario theme and the [starts making a beat], you know, all that kind of thing.
Tyler further elaborates,"I wanted to have built-in nostalgia, almost like when people watched it, even fans would be like, 'Yeah, I know this, this feels like Mario.' But at the same time, having support motifs that would be almost like counter melodies or support harmonies that would be from the original games that would go alongside it in a way that would be invisible to people that were new to the Mario world. So it just felt like great film music.
